The Good Doctor 
season 2 has wasted no time getting things kicked off — pre-production has been in the works for some time and this past week, the cast officially started to reassemble in Vancouver for production to officially kick off!

While we have not seen any official glimpses as of yet of any characters in costume, or major teases as to what’s coming in terms of the story, there are a couple new tidbits that we’ve got within this piece that are worth celebrating.

1. This new behind-the-scenes tease from Daniel Dae Kim – You may have seen a photo already of the first table read of the season, but how about something featuring the cast members proclaiming that work is underway! This is worth a smile, and it’s also a reminder of how fantastic Kim is at promoting this show behind the scenes. He’s an executive producer on the project, and because of his interest in the original Korean version, he’s one of the main reasons why we have a series in America to begin with. We’re probably going to keep pushing for him to have an on-screen presence on the series, but even if that never happens, it’s still nice to see that he remains so involved.

Richard Schiff tees up season 2 – We don’t think that the video below featuring the actor is altogether spoilery at all, but it is still fun to watch as he does his part in order to generate a little bit more interest into whether or not Dr. Glassman survives. We do remain optimistic that he will find a way to recover from his cancer surgery, but we wouldn’t be surprised if, at least in the early going, he does not have all that much of a presence while at the St. Bonaventure Hospital. Nonetheless, we do anticipate some sort of return in due time.
